    my wife has been fighting this monster now for the better part of 2 years and putting up one hell of a fight…she has continued to work through most of those 2 years, even while recieveing chemo and the y-90 treatment because she said it kept her busy and her mind off of this monster…ive seen how she would drag herself out of bed aganist my wishes and go to work, she has a strong will…she did this up to 8 months ago and couldnt do it anymore so the doctors put her out on disability which they wanted to do from the beginning…while she was out on disability she had her company benefits so her medical care was taken care of …now we just learned that her company is going out of business and her medical benefits will end the end of this month…not to worry i told her we will just pick up the policy (corbra) and pay the monthly premium for the same coverage that by law they have to offer you…well it didnt turn out that way…it seems by law they have to offer you a policy but not the same coverage…the policy they offer covers nothing but some, some of her blood work, no infusions, no port flushings, no chemo or chemo meds.and no treatment for high calcium and i can have all of this for 800 dollars a month…dont you love insurence co. they will let me pay for nothing…when i ask for a policy that covers her treatment needs they say sorry there arent any..im willing to pay and i cant get coverage for her and i have tried them all… so now we go to social security and try to get medicare..we are once again told sorry we can not help you, your wife is to young (58) for medicare and hasnt been disable long enough to be eligible for benefits…seems that you have to be disable for 2 years before you are eligible for medicare…so where does a person go in a situation like this…to me its just unbelieveable how they just dont seem to care about the people in this country….well i think i went on long enough, there is more lots more but thats it in a nut shell…again im sorry for the long post and know that you all have been in our prayers and will remain there…..lucille and ron

    hi karen, welcome to our family….sorry to hear about mom and wish her the best……my wife has had the y-90 treatment about a year ago and i believe it was the best treatment out there for her, everyones case is different…..as far as the procedure goes it is fairly simple as the doctors will explain to you…..first she must be a candidate for the treatment…the doctors will run a series of tests and than do a trial run using a placebo instead of the y-90….once this part of the procedure is done they will take x-rays to see if there is any leakage and to where its going….since y-90 is internal radiation not having any leakage is very important …but even if there is leakage the doctors can stop it. as for the after effects my wife did very well, the only thing was she was fatigued for 3- 4 days other than that she came away from the procedure fine but everyone is different…i know all of this is scary but the doctors and yourself will come up with the right decision…as for my wife i believe the y-90 was the best choice for her and i believe the best treatment out there,,,i have a cd explaining and showing how the procedure goes step by step if somehow i could give it to you i will…….good luck to your mom …..ron and lucille
